• If you want to stop driving for the day, screw off the glow plug and drip a few drops of after-run engine oil (low-viscosity machine oil) into the cylinder. Replace
the glow plug and turn the model upside down a couple of time so that the oil can spread in the combustion chamber. This prevents corrosion.
• If you do not use the model for a longer period of time, e.g. in winter, drip 2 - 3 drops of preservation oil (accessory) into the cylinder.
• Fix fuel hoses on the connector nipples with thin cable binders or special hose binders (accessories). Otherwise the oil in the fuel can cause slipping.
Air filter
The air filter prevents dirt from getting into the engine with the intake air. Foreign objects sucked in between the cylinder liner and the piston cause piston jams,
which destroy the engine and result in subsequent damage to the power train.
• The air filter also must be cleaned and re-oiled regularly.
• Clean the air filter with petroleum or low viscosity machine oil (air filter oil, accessories).
• Oil the air filter afterwards with air filter oil.
• Never drive without an air filter!
• Fasten the air filter with a thin cable binder.
• The air filter insert must be examined for defects (holes, etc.) regularly and be replaced when required.

b) Batteries and Rechargeable Batteries
You as the end user are required by law (Battery Ordinance) to return all used batteries/rechargeable batteries. Disposing of them in the household
waste is prohibited!
Batteries/rechargeable batteries that include hazardous substances are labelled with these symbols to indicate that disposal in domestic waste is
forbidden. The symbols for the respective heavy metal are: Cd = cadmium, Hg = mercury, Pb = lead (the names are indicated on the battery/
rechargeable battery e.g. below the rubbish bin symbols shown to the left).
You may return used batteries/rechargeable batteries free of charge to any collecting point in your local community, in our stores or everywhere
else where batteries/rechargeable batteries are sold.
You thus fulfil your statutory obligations and contribute to the protection of the environment.
